SWAMI


Meaning of SWAMI in English

/swah"mee/ , n. , pl. swamies .

1. an honorific title given to a Hindu religious teacher.

2. a person resembling a swami, esp. in authority, critical judgment, etc.; pundit: The swamis are saying the stock market is due for a drop.

Also, swamy .

[ 1765-75; svami, nom. sing. of svamin master, owner ]
